Draw a circle with your compass. Draw in a diameter. Construct a perpendicular bisector of the diameter. Construct angle bisectors of all four angles at the center of the circle. Mark where all these lines intersect the circle. Connect these points. Prove that the shape you have constructed is a regular octagon.
